Chess. A 19th-century bone "Selenus" pattern chess set, comprising 32 pieces, one side stained red the other natural, the king's 9.5cm high, the pawn's 4cm, natural king and rook with old hairline cracks, some general loss of red staining, contained in a mahogany box together with a set of wooden draughts, comprising 12 rosewood and 12 light boxwood, plus 28 ebony and bone dominoes, complete with mahogany, rosewood and boxwood hinged games board, 33 x 33.5cm
